AI Summary
-
Amends the Subsidized Housing Joint Occupancy Act to add legislative findings recognizing that elderly parents of adult children with disabilities frequently desire to share a residence to reduce housing costs, provide protection, and assist with daily tasks.
-
Adds findings that federal HUD rules do not require persons of different generations or opposite sex to share the same bedroom in federally subsidized housing, but local housing authorities frequently impose such requirements based on their own occupancy standards.
-
Directs the State of Illinois to assist elderly persons and persons with disabilities in maximizing the effectiveness of their incomes and preventing unnecessary burden in accomplishing daily tasks of life.
